Output ef89011694e56478add2ada26da9236ae025581876c08c157d719525945594e7:0

value
2973
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 90ebbe031f3c36a0a961def6aa33ea791cfe43b605da03b3808f224791aaf22d
address
bc1pjr4muqcl8sm2p2tpmmm25vl20yw0usakqhdq8vuq3u3y0yd27gksh54lnc
transaction
ef89011694e56478add2ada26da9236ae025581876c08c157d719525945594e7